The PHS-memory 32GB RAM is specifically designed for the Gigabyte AORUS 7 SB-7DE1130SD model and offers high performance for demanding applications. With a memory clock frequency of 2933 MHz and DDR4 technology, this SO-DIMM RAM ensures fast data processing and improved system response times. The 32 GB storage capacity allows for running multiple applications simultaneously, enhancing efficiency and productivity. The RAM is equipped with 260 pins and operates at a voltage of 1.2 volts, making it energy-efficient. These features make the RAM an ideal choice for users seeking powerful and reliable memory expansion for their Gigabyte AORUS 7 SB-7DE1130SD.
